Back when Erica was at the height of her popularity AMC was run by individuals who knew how to balance the show and never let any of their characters get too overexposed.

Erica was always just one of the female leads and there were not just 2 of them either. In the early 70's she shared the spotlight with Tara & Ann who were the other 2 main leads with both Ruth and Phoebe getting quite a bit of air time too along with Mary & Kitty.

In the latter part of the 70's, Erica shared the spotlight with Ruth who really got more air time then than the early 70's. Tara was still running strong along with Donna and for awhile still Ann, Kitty, and Estelle too. Also Brooke was really starting to come into her own.

Then the 80's brought Brooke, Nina, Daisy, Donna, Jenny, Opal, Natalie, Liza, Ellen, and Angie who all got a lot of air time along with Erica.

AMC really knew back then how to balance their leads back then. All the decades AMC has had some strong female characters but I think the ladies of the 80's were the best. So many of them bounced back and forth from lead to supporting all the time. They were all great characters and all were very well cast.
